Как добавить опцию в коллекцию флажков simpleform с jquery? - PullRequest
0 голосов
/ 30 апреля 2020

Если я получил их в простой форме Rails:

<%= f.input :events, collection: @organizer.events.order(:start_time).reverse, label_method: :event_name_and_date, input_html: {multiple: true, id: "event_select"} %>
<%= f.input :event_pass, :as => :check_boxes, include_hidden: false, :input_html => { :multiple => true }, wrapper_html: {:id => "event_pass_select"} %>

Как добавить выбранный #event_select в качестве параметров в коллекцию #event_pass?

I ' ve получил:

$('#event_select').on('change', function(){
  var grab_events = $('#event_select').val();

  $.each(grab_events, function( index, value ) {
    $("#event_pass_select").append($("<option>")
      .val(value)
      .html(value)
    );
  });
})

, но он просто добавляет идентификаторы в виде строк под флажками да / нет

...